Hello Nick,
Take a look at transaction SU24 to determine what authorisation objects are checked by any transaction.
That is a good proposition, in fact. Tbh i generally use ST01 to trace the auth. checks which occur at runtime when calling a transaction.
If i am not wrong SU24 is not a mandatory activity. But it does help when creating Auth. profiles, hence a good-to-have. I say this from my previous project experience where previously we did not maintain SU24 customization for any (custom) transaction. But later we were advised to fill the SU24 settings as it helped the Security team in setting up Auth. profiles.
May be this is not the case for Std. SAP Tcodes.

Hi Suhas,
I completely agree. While i think it's good practice to maintain SU24 for custom transactions it can't relied on, and only a trace will give you the definitive view.
As for how well SU24 is populated for SAP Tcodes, I couldn't possibly comment.......

I find the best way is to set a break-point at statement AUTHORITY-CHECK. And then execute your steps. The breakpoint will be hit when an authority check is reached. This allows you to see the exact point of the process where the user's authorisation is being checked. The authorisation object being checked is specified in the code.
